Numbers 24:15-25 - Balaam's Fourth Oracle

15 So he took up his parable and said, - The oracle of Balaam, son of Beer, Yea the oracle of the man, of opened eye; 16 The oracle of one hearing sayings of GOD, And knowing the knowledge of the Most High, - Who the sight of the Almighty, receiveth in vision, Who falleth down but hath unveiled eyes: - 17 I see One, who is not now, I observe One, who is not nigh, - There hath marched forth a Star out of Jacob. And arisen a Sceptre out of Israel, That hath dishonoured the beard of Mesh, Yea the crown of the head of all the tumultuous; 18 So Edom hath become a possession, Yea a possession is Seir to his foes, - But, Israel, is doing valiantly; 19 Yea One wieldeth dominion out of Jacob, - Who hath destroyed the remnant out of the fortress.

20 And, when he saw Amalek, he took up, his parable, and said - The beginning of nations, - Amalek, But his latter end is even to perish.

21 And when he saw the Kenite, he took up hi parable, and said, - Enduring thy dwelling-place, Set thou then in the crag, thy nest; 22 Yet shall it be for destruction, O Kain, - How long shall Assyria hold thee captive?

23 And he took up his parable, and said, - Alas who shall survive its fulfillment by GOD; 24 When, ships, come from the coast of the isles, And humble Assyria, and humble the Hebrew, - And he too, is even to perish?

25 Then Balaam arose, and went and returned unto his place, - and, Balak also, went his way.
